The 2-Minute Rule for what is md5 technology
The 2-Minute Rule for what is md5 technology
Blog Article
Preimage attacks. MD5 is at risk of preimage attacks, where an attacker can find an input that hashes to a specific price. This ability to reverse-engineer a hash weakens MD5’s success in safeguarding sensitive information.
append "1" bit to concept< // Notice: the input bytes are regarded as little bit strings, // where by the 1st little bit may be the most vital bit of the byte.[fifty three] // Pre-processing: padding with zeros
Being a cryptographic hash, it's got recognized security vulnerabilities, which include a large probable for collisions, which is when two distinctive messages end up with exactly the same created hash price. MD5 might be efficiently used for non-cryptographic capabilities, which include as being a checksum to confirm knowledge integrity versus unintentional corruption. MD5 is actually a 128-little bit algorithm. Despite having its regarded protection challenges, it remains Just about the most commonly used message-digest algorithms.
MD5 is broadly used in electronic signatures, checksums, together with other stability purposes. One example is, quite a few program suppliers use MD5 checksums to verify the integrity in their downloadable application, making certain that users are certainly not downloading a modified or corrupted Edition of your application.
During this tutorial, we explored the MD5 hashing algorithm, understanding its intent and internal workings. We acquired that whilst MD5 was the moment commonly employed, it really is no more proposed for cryptographic needs due to its vulnerabilities. Nevertheless, researching MD5 helps us grasp the basic ideas of hashing algorithms.
Collision Resistance: MD5 was originally collision-resistant, as two individual inputs that give the exact same hash price need to be computationally unachievable. In practice, nevertheless, vulnerabilities that enable collision attacks are already found out.
It had been posted in the public domain a 12 months afterwards. Just a year later a “pseudo-collision” on the MD5 compression purpose was found out. The timeline of MD5 discovered (and exploited) vulnerabilities is as follows:
MD3 is Yet one more hash functionality built by Ron Rivest. It experienced quite a few flaws and hardly ever definitely created it out in the laboratory…
Our offerings might not include or guard towards just about every sort of criminal offense, fraud, or threat we publish about. Our goal is to boost consciousness about Cyber Safety. Be sure to overview complete Phrases all through enrollment or setup. Take into account that no one can avert all id theft or cybercrime, and that LifeLock will not keep an eye on all transactions at all firms. The Norton and LifeLock models are A part of Gen Digital Inc.
A 12 months afterwards, in 2006, an algorithm was posted that employed tunneling to locate a collision within just just one minute on only one laptop computer.
The MD5 hash functionality’s stability is looked upon as seriously compromised. Collisions are available inside of seconds, and they may be utilized for destructive needs. Actually, in 2012, the Flame spy ware that infiltrated A large number of desktops and units in Iran was thought of one of several most troublesome stability issues of the calendar year.
MD5 hash algorithm can be a cryptographic hash functionality that requires input messages and makes a hard and fast measurement 128-bit hash worth irrespective click here of the dimensions of your input concept. MD5 was created in 1991 by Ronald Rivest to validate info integrity, detect tampering, and generate digital signatures.
Products Merchandise With adaptability and neutrality within the Main of our Okta and Auth0 Platforms, we make seamless and safe obtain feasible in your clients, personnel, and associates.
In some instances, the checksum can not be trustworthy (by way of example, if it had been attained more than a similar channel given that the downloaded file), through which scenario MD5 can only offer mistake-checking performance: it will eventually acknowledge a corrupt or incomplete down load, which becomes far more possible when downloading greater documents.